OpenClaw安全审计全解析:从风险识别到合规实践的关键指南
在开源社区与企业级应用中,OpenClaw作为一款专注于容器化环境下的轻量级安全工具,正逐步获得DevSecOps团队的关注。然而,随着其部署场景的扩展,围绕“OpenClaw安全审计”的讨论不再仅仅局限于工具本身的功能测试,而是延伸至更深层的风险管理、配置合规性以及长期运维的可追溯性。本文将从OpenClaw的审计切入点出发,梳理安全审计的核心维度与实用方法。
首先,理解OpenClaw的审计范围至关重要。OpenClaw主要提供二进制文件的签名验证、运行时的完整性检查以及策略执行能力。在安全审计中,重点应放在其签名校验机制的可靠性上。审计人员需要确认OpenClaw所依赖的根证书是否被正确配置,以及签名数据库是否与上游同步。一旦签名数据库被篡改或证书链断裂,整个信任模型将失效。因此,审计的第一步便是检查OpenClaw的密钥管理流程,包括密钥的生成、存储与轮换策略是否符合行业标准(如NIST SP 800-57)。
其次,运行时审计是OpenClaw安全性的关键验证环节。审计人员可以通过抓取OpenClaw的日志输出,分析其在容器启动时是否准确拦截了未经签名的镜像。实践中,常见的问题包括:策略过于宽松导致未签名镜像被放行,或者策略过于严格导致正常应用启动失败。审计时应重点比对OpenClaw的规则引擎与组织内部的安全基线是否一致。同时,建议审计团队使用模拟攻击(如伪造签名或替换合法二进制)来测试OpenClaw的逃逸防御能力,确保其异常检测逻辑能够抵御真实的提权威胁。
此外,合规性审计同样不可忽视。许多企业对容器镜像的安全性有明确的合规要求,例如PCI DSS或SOC 2对软件供应链的追溯要求。OpenClaw的审计记录必须包含每次镜像验证的时间戳、签名指纹、操作者标识以及决策结果。审计报告需要能够清晰展示这些记录是否经过加密存储,并具备防篡改的Hash链。在部署OpenClaw的Kubernetes集群中,审计数据应纳入集中式日志平台(如ELK或Splunk),以便定期进行趋势分析与异常告警。
最后,针对OpenClaw的持续审计需关注版本更新与兼容性。由于OpenClaw处于快速迭代阶段,每次更新都可能引入新的审计字段或修改策略语法。审计团队应建立版本对照表,确保审计脚本与当前部署的OpenClaw版本匹配。同时,建议每季度执行一次第三方渗透测试,重点测试OpenClaw的审计日志是否能够抵御log注入与时间篡改攻击。只有将OpenClaw纳入完整的自动审计流水线,企业才能真正实现从“安全工具部署”到“可信运行时环境”的跨越。